What is the expanded visitation regime and when does it apply in Peru?
The extended visitation regime is a modality that allows establishing a longer period of coexistence between the non-custodial parent and the minor. It is applied in cases where it is considered beneficial for the well-being of the minor to have a closer relationship with the non-custodial parent, as long as their routine and regular development are not compromised.

What is the role of civil society in preventing money laundering in Mexico?
Mexico Civil society plays an important role in preventing money laundering in Mexico. Civil society organizations can collaborate with authorities and financial institutions in disseminating information and raising awareness about the risks of money laundering. Additionally, they can get involved in promoting transparency, accountability and business ethics, as well as monitoring potential cases of money laundering and reporting suspicious activities.
What occupational health and safety measures should companies in Panama take to prevent sanctions?
Companies in Panama must implement occupational health and safety measures, such as risk assessments, safety training, and providing protective equipment. This not only ensures a safe work environment, but also reduces the risk of sanctions for regulatory non-compliance.
